Thermodynamic properties


Phase behavior
Triple point 159 K (−114 °C), ? Pa
Critical point 514 K (241 °C), 63 bar
Std enthalpy change
of fusion
, ΔfusHo
+4.9 kJ/mol
Std entropy change
of fusion
, ΔfusSo
+31 J/(mol·K)
Std enthalpy change
of vaporization
, ΔvapHo
+38.56 kJ/mol
Std entropy change
of vaporization
, ΔvapSo

Liquid properties
Std enthalpy change
of formation
, ΔfHoliquid
−277.38 kJ/mol
Standard molar entropy,
Soliquid
159.9 J/(mol K)
Heat capacity, cp 112.4 J/(mol K)
Gas properties
Std enthalpy change
of formation
, ΔfHogas
−235.3 kJ/mol
Standard molar entropy,
Sogas
283 J/(mol K)
Heat capacity, cp 65.21 J/(mol K)
